G E Shipping inks contract to buy two Aframax Crude Carrier

09 Nov 2016 Evaluate

Great Eastern Shipping Company (G E Shipping) has signed a contract to buy two Aframax Crude Carriers of about 105,000 dwt each. The 2011 & 2012 built vessels are expected to join the company's fleet by Q4 FY17.

The company's current fleet stands at 37 vessels, comprising 24 tankers (7 crude carriers, 15 product tankers, 2 LPG carrier) and 13 dry bulk carriers (1 Capesize, 7 Kamsarmax, 5 Supramax) with an average age of 8.93 years aggregating 2.88 mn dwt. Additionally, the company has 1 Newbuilding Kamsarmax and a 2009 built Supramax on order.

Great Eastern Shipping Company is India’s largest private sector shipping company. The company’s major businesses include shipping and offshore.
